Postby staff » Mon Sep 16, 2019 10:42 pm

Hello, this recipe must be systematically Water-in-Oil Instead, if you want lightness, you can remove WaterGuard™ Ultra from the formula because It's quite sticky. If the formula is a system Water-in-Oil is already waterproof to some extent. The oil part 10% Titanium Dioxide 15nm Liquid (Gloss), 10 % Zinc Oxide 35nm Liquid , 5% PMMA Booster 5% Silicone Gel (Ultra Clear), 5% Dimethicone 1Secs, 0.3% Beige Iron Oxides EasyMix™ 3% Squalane 1% Ethyl Ferulate Use Water-in-Oil EZ 3% or SiliSolve Plus 1% in The soldering, by blending it to the top of this part, water 5% QuikBlur™ 2% Niacinamide 0.5% Magnesium Ascorbyl Phosphate 0.1% Calcium Pantothenate 1% Mild Preserved Eco™ 0.2% Disodium EDTA water to 100% (other items that the team has eliminated Means cannot be put in this formula. or inappropriate to put in this recipe) The mixing process is Blend the water parts together, blend the oil parts together, while blending the oil parts. Gradually add water to the oil part a little at a time. (Do not alternate)
